2610 DO Sensor MODBUS Manual

Live Salinity Value
The live salinity value is used to correct the oxygen concentration value for salinity. Values must be written
in Practical Salinity Units (PSU) in the range 0 to 42 PSU. This is not a measured parameter.

Default Salinity Value
The default salinity value is loaded into the live salinity value register when power is fi rst applied to the
probe. The default salinity value is used in calculations until a live salinity value is written. This is not a
measured parameter.

Live Barometric Pressure
The live barometric pressure is used in the calculation of percent saturation and to determine the theoretical
saturation point during calibration. Values must be written in millibars in the range 506.625 to 1114.675
mbar. This is not a measured parameter.

Default Barometric Pressure
The default barometric pressure is loaded into the live barometric pressure register when power is applied
to the probe. The default barometric pressure is used in calculations until a live barometric pressure is
written. This is not a measured parameter.

100% Saturation Calibration Values
These values represent the sensor conditions while the probe is in a 100% saturation calibration
environment. These are not measured values, they are written by the controller during the calibration
process.
Writes to these registers are only accepted if the probe is in the calibration mode. The probe will return
exception 0x85 (invalid device command sequence) if an attempt is made to write these registers when the
calibration mode is off.

0% Saturation Calibration Values
These values represent the sensor conditions while the probe is in a 0% saturation calibration environment.
These are not measured values, they are written by the controller during the calibration process.
Writes to these registers are only accepted if the probe is in the calibration mode. The probe will return
exception 0x85 (invalid device command sequence) if an attempt is made to write these registers when the
calibration mode is off.

Calibration Slope and Offset
These values represent the slope and offset that will be applied to the raw concentration reading from the
sensor to generate the fi nal values reported by the sensor parameters. These registers may be written
independently of the normal internal calibration procedure.
